软件工具 SofTool.CN 本次搜索耗时 0.252 秒,为您找到 133 个相关结果.
  • GtkDial

    2659 2021-05-11 《GTK+ 2.0 中文教程》
    gtkdial.h gtkdial.c dial_test.c gtkdial.h /* GTK - GIMP工具包 * 版权 (C) 1995-1997 Peter Mattis, Spencer Kimball 和 Josh MacDonald 所有 * * 本程序是自由软件。你可以在自由软件基金发布的 GNU GPL 的条款下重新分发...
  • 数据类型

    2630 2021-04-28 《GTK+ 2.0 中文教程》
    你或许发现前述示例中有几个地方需要解释,例如:gint、gchar 等等。你看到的这些被分别定义了类型别名(typedefs)到 int 和 char,它们是 GLib 系统的一部分。这样做的目的可以避免在计算时对简单数据类型的大小(size)的依赖。 一个好的示例是 “gint32” 被定义为任何平台的32位整数,无论是64位的i386,还是32位的a...
  • 28_定时器

    2629 2021-04-29 《GTK系列教程》
    定时器的创建: 使用实例: 定时器的移除: 倒计时实例如下: 定时器在应用编程里用得很广,我们手机里的闹钟,幻灯片播放图片等应用都用到定时器。定时器,每隔一段时间干一件事(程序里表现为调用一个函数),像闹钟,每隔一天响一次。 定时器的创建: guint g_timeout_add(guint interval, GSourceFunc fun...
  • 27_改变控件字体大小

    2626 2021-04-29 《GTK系列教程》
    改变控件字体大小: #include <gtk/gtk.h> /* 功能: 设置控件字体大小 * widget: 需要改变字体的控件 * size: 字体大小 * is_button: TRUE代表控件为按钮,FALSE为其它控件 */ static void set_widget_font_si...
  • 22_常用控件之进度条

    2598 2021-04-29 《GTK系列教程》
    进度条的创建: 设置进度条显示的进度比例: 设置进度条显示的进度比例: 设置滑槽上的文本显示: 设置进度条的移动方向: 获取进度条的方向: 例子代码如下: 我们到处都能看到进度条的应用,我们下载拷贝个文件,下载个电影等总能看到进度条的影子,如图: 进度条的常用操作无非设置其比例或者获取其比例。 进度条的创建: GtkWidget *g...
  • 对话框

    2596 2021-04-29 《GTK+ 2.0 中文教程》
    对话框 Dialogs 对话框 Dialogs 对话控件非常简单,事实上它仅仅是一个预先添加了几个控件到里面的窗口。 对话框的数据结构是: struct GtkDialog { GtkWindow window ; GtkWidget *vbox; GtkWidget *action_area; }; 从上...
  • 16_glade的环境搭建

    2585 2021-04-29 《GTK系列教程》
    1) Linux环境搭建 2)windows版本环境搭建 1) Linux环境搭建 在线安装即可,安装命令如下: sudo apt-get install glade libglade2-dev 测试是否安装成功,在终端敲 glade 即可: 2)windows版本环境搭建 下载一个windows版本,点击此处即可: 此处待补充链接...
  • 08_布局容器之水平布局

    2582 2021-04-29 《GTK系列教程》
    布局容器的主要分类: 水平布局容器: 水平布局容器的创建: 容器添加添加控件: 显示容器上所有控件: 完整代码如下: 如果我们希望窗口里多放添加几个控件,直接添加是不成功的,因为窗口只能容纳一个控件的容器。这时候,我们需要借助布局容器,我们先把布局容器添加到窗口里,然后再把所需要添加的控件放在布局容器里。 布局容器的主要分类: 水平布局...
  • 一个控件的剖析

    2554 2021-05-11 《GTK+ 2.0 中文教程》
    要想创建一个新的控件,最重要的是要对 GTK 对象的工作原理有所了解。这一节只是一个简述,详见参考手册。 GTK 控件具有面向对象的特性。然而,它是用标准的 C 实现的。这极大的改善了在当前 C++ 编译器上使用的可移植性和稳定性;但是,这也意味着写控件的人必须注意一些实现的细节。一个控件类的所有实例(比如所有的按钮控件)的共有信息存储在类结构 里,类的信...
  • 绘图区 Drawing Area

    2525 2021-05-07 《GTK+ 2.0 中文教程》
    绘图区控件和绘图 创建后端位图: expose_event 暴露事件 其它绘图函数 绘图区控件和绘图 现在,我们开始向屏幕绘图。 我们使用的构件是绘图区控件。一个绘图区控件本质上是一个 X 窗口 ,没有其它的东西。它是一个空白的画布,我们可以在其上绘制需要的东西。 创建一个绘图区: GtkWidget* gtk_drawing_ar...